What are the most common GMC repairs needed by drivers in the Randall, MN area?

Due to our rural roads, harsh winters, and towing/hauling demands, common local repairs include suspension components (ball joints, control arms), brake system wear, 4WD/AWD system maintenance, and diesel engine maintenance for Duramax trucks. Corrosion from road salt is also a frequent concern for frames and brake lines.

When should I seek immediate service for my GMC in central Minnesota?

Seek immediate service for warning lights like "Service 4WD," "Reduced Engine Power," or check engine lights with noticeable performance loss, especially before long drives on Highway 10 or in winter conditions. Unusual noises from the drivetrain or steering, and brake issues, are also critical for safety on our rural roads.

What local factors should I consider when scheduling GMC maintenance in Randall?

Schedule critical pre-winter checks (battery, 4WD system, tires) in early fall before the first freeze, as shops get very busy. For farmers or those with seasonal vehicles, consider spring servicing after storage. Also, plan for potential longer part delivery times compared to major metro areas for less common components.
